The Science Behind Sapphire Coatings

Sapphire, the crystalline type of aluminum oxide (Al₂O₃), ranks as one of many hardest naturally occurring supplies after diamond. When utilized as a skinny coating to tweeter domes, it theoretically affords a number of acoustic benefits. The fabric’s distinctive rigidity ought to reduce undesirable resonances and breakup modes that may shade sound replica, whereas its low mass addition preserves the motive force’s transient response traits.

The coating course of sometimes entails vapor deposition or sputtering strategies, creating an ultra-thin sapphire layer over conventional dome supplies like aluminum, titanium, or material. This hybrid strategy goals to mix the bottom materials’s favorable traits with sapphire’s mechanical properties – making a dome that’s concurrently light-weight, inflexible, and acoustically inert.

Measurable Enhancements vs. Theoretical Advantages

Unbiased acoustic measurements of sapphire-coated tweeters reveal some fascinating patterns. Laboratory checks typically present modest enhancements in frequency response linearity, notably within the vital 8-15 kHz vary the place many conventional tweeters exhibit irregularities. The improved rigidity does seem to push breakup modes larger in frequency, probably shifting distortion artifacts past the audible vary.

Nevertheless, the magnitude of those enhancements raises questions on their sensible significance. Whereas harmonic distortion measurements might present 1-2 dB reductions at sure frequencies, these variations typically fall inside the margin of error for typical listening room acoustics and particular person listening to variations. Extra importantly, blind listening checks have produced blended outcomes, with skilled listeners generally struggling to persistently establish sapphire-coated tweeters in managed comparisons.

Actual-World Efficiency Issues

In sensible listening environments, the advantages of sapphire coatings face a number of limiting elements. Room acoustics, speaker positioning, and system matching sometimes have far larger influence on sound high quality than refined tweeter materials variations. A $1,000 pair of well-designed audio system in an acoustically handled room will typically outperform $5,000 sapphire-equipped displays in a reverberant area with poor setup.

Moreover, the human auditory system’s frequency response and masking results imply that theoretical enhancements in tweeter efficiency don’t all the time translate to audible variations. The ear’s sensitivity drops considerably above 15 kHz, precisely the place many sapphire coating advantages are most pronounced. For listeners over 30, age-related listening to loss additional reduces sensitivity to those ultra-high frequencies.

Manufacturing High quality vs. Supplies Innovation

A number of the most revered speaker producers obtain distinctive tweeter efficiency by means of cautious engineering of standard supplies somewhat than unique coatings. Correct motor design, optimized magnetic subject geometry, and exact manufacturing tolerances typically yield larger sonic enhancements than materials upgrades alone.

Firms like Seas, ScanSpeak, and Morel produce reference-quality tweeters utilizing aluminum, material, or titanium domes that measure and sound remarkably much like their sapphire-coated opponents. This means that implementation and engineering execution matter greater than uncooked materials properties in attaining high-performance audio replica.
